Bank of China can't accept remittance from abroad.
Most overseas remittances need to go through transit, which may be different every time, so the arrival time will be different.

I suggest you check with the remitter first to see if there is any wrong payee information. Sometimes a slight mistake (such as spelling mistakes in name and address) will cause the remittance to be returned without being recorded, and the remitter needs to send a telegram to correct it.

The bank won't check it for you. Maybe the money hasn't arrived yet and it can't be found in its system. I suggest you check with the account bank of the payee's account, because if the overseas remittance arrives, but it can't enter the payee's account, it will usually be put in the account of the payee's account first to ask for assistance.
